Test method for single pile vertical static load test under stable confined water condition

2017 
The invention discloses a test method for a single pile vertical static load test under the stable confined water condition. The test method comprises the following steps that (1) the size of a model pile and the thicknesses of soil bodies in a box are determined; (2) the water pressure of a pressure bearing layer is determined; (3) soil layers are paved by layers, and the model pile is buried; (4) force transferring water bags are placed; (5) back pressure plates are placed; (6) a vertical loading system and a data acquisition system are placed; (7) the water pressure of the pressure bearing layer is loaded; (8) the loading level is determined, and graded loading is implemented; (9) the pile top is vertically loaded; (10) the vertical compressive ultimate bearing capacity of the model pile is determined; (11) a test device is disassembled; (12) the vertical bearing capacity characteristic value of the single pile is determined; and (13) the pressure of a confined water layer is adjusted, the water pressure of the pressure bearing layer is increased to the next level, and the steps (2) to (12) are repeated to obtain the characteristic values of the pile foundation vertical bearing capacity under different confined water pressure conditions. The test method is good in effect, convenient to operate, low in cost and short in time.
